We select French, American, Russian or European oak trees at least 150-200 years old.
The rough staves undergo a proactive maturation process lasting for 24 months on average at our seasoning yard in Cognac.
Rough staves are transformed into staves in the hands of expert coopers.
Master coopers make the barrel shells using traditional tools.
The fire then starts its magic: a triple time waltz!
Once the shell and heads have been raised, it is time for the finishing touches.
